Front maybe 215 70 14 rear 245 60 14 anyone got the 245 on the rear of there 69 darts how do they look and fit.
 
Hi Snake. I am wondering about the same thing. Will the 245's fit in the wheel well without scraping ? Do you know what the tread width is on these ? I've been away from Darts for about 25 or so years, and I can't remember what you can get in there without scrapping. Maybe 9 or 9 1/2" I think. By the way I am restoring my first car that I owned when I was in high school and it happens to be a 69 Swinger B5 blue, white stripe,340 4-speed.
 
I have 245 60 14 with a 14 x 7 with a 4.5 back space.
They fit great

Thanks for the compliments. Rims are 14x6. Lip to the tire is about an inch. Tire to spring is about an inch and a half.
With that much clearance you have a 4" offset. I have a 4-1/2 offset and have about 1/4 inch space to the leaf spring. I wonder if you could fit 255s in there?

A 255 sounds like it will fit in a stock spring location stock fender lip Dart. Now I have been wondering. If you roll the fender lip and use the off set spring kit with just the right off set rim. Will a 275 fit in there? HMMM:read2:
 
I am in the process of doing that right now. I am installing the offset spring kit and getting steel rims made by stockton that are 15 x 8 with a 5" backspace with 275 60 15 ET street radials. I will have to roll the wheel lip. Hope everything works out.

I run 245/60x15 on 15x6.5" rallye's on the back and 245/60x14 on 14x6' on the front with no issues on my 69 dart. I have super stock 002/003 springs in the stock location.

Stevedart it will work out fine. I did the same thing your doing with stockton rally wheels in the back. 27" X 10.5" on 15's fit fine. I've got about an inch on each side and went with a 5.5 back set but think 5 would have been better.
